Films: Inferno (1980)

Alias: The Mother of Darkness

Type: Mystical

Location: Haunted Home

Height/Weight: That of an average human.

Affiliation: Evil

Summary: Remember Helena Markos from a couple years ago? Well, that was only one out of three of the "Mothers" that represent the worst of witchcraft. Here, we have the youngest out of them, Mater Tenebrarum.

History: The Mother of Darkness, Tenebrarum lived in New York City, operating mainly from the shadows. She was also the one who got to keep Vareli, the architect tricked into building the mothers' lairs. In her secluded home, she orchestrates the deaths of the many living their daily lives, condemning them to cruel and unusual demises. Those who try to trail it to her are often dealt with quickly.

Notable Kills: As if unleashing a group of hungry rats onto a person wasn't enough, she possesses a hot dog vendor into stabbing him to death as well.

Final Fate: Just as Tenebrarum has a major investigator in her clutches, a fire started by one of her victims destroys her home with her in it. She sadly says how it all burned like last time, referencing the fate of Markos, before she's taken out by the flame.

Powers/Abilities: None

Weakness: Anything conventional.

Scariness Factor: 4-Out of all the Mothers, Tenebrarum stands out as the most sadistic. There may not be any pools of barbed wire, but there are violent glass decapitations and rat assaults all around. Some argue that she's Death itself, though even the Reaper probably hates her too.

Trivia: -Out of all his films, Dario Argento considers this to be his least favorite, mainly due to how he suffered Hepatitis midway through production.

-That creepy music student in the film? That was Mater Lachrymarum, the final Mother, and a figure we'll see a couple decades later...
